Main Page   Namespace List   Class Hierarchy   Alphabetical List   Compound List   File List   Compound Members   File Members  

gnFileSource Member List

This is the complete list of members for gnFileSource, including all inherited members.
Clone() const=0gnFileSource [pure virtual]
Close()gnFileSource [virtual]
DetermineNewlineType()gnFileSource [protected]
GetContigID(const string &name) const=0gnBaseSource [pure virtual]
GetContigListLength() const=0gnBaseSource [pure virtual]
GetContigName(const uint32 i) const=0gnBaseSource [pure virtual]
GetContigSeqLength(const uint32 i) const=0gnBaseSource [pure virtual]
GetFileContig(const uint32 contigI) const=0gnFileSource [pure virtual]
GetFilter() constgnFileSource [inline, virtual]
GetOpenString() constgnFileSource [inline, virtual]
GetSpec() const=0gnBaseSource [pure virtual]
gnBaseSource()gnBaseSource [inline]
gnClone()gnClone [inline]
gnFileSource()gnFileSource [inline]
gnFileSource(const gnFileSource &gnfs)gnFileSource
HasContig(const string &name) const=0gnBaseSource [pure virtual]
m_ifstreamgnFileSource [protected]
m_newlineSizegnFileSource [protected]
m_newlineTypegnFileSource [protected]
m_openStringgnFileSource [protected]
m_pFiltergnFileSource [protected]
Open(string openString)gnFileSource [virtual]
Open()gnFileSource [virtual]
ParseStream(istream &fin)=0gnFileSource [private, pure virtual]
Read(const uint64 pos, char *buf, uint32 &bufLen)gnFileSource [virtual]
SeqRead(const gnSeqI start, char *buf, uint32 &bufLen, const uint32 contigI=ALL_CONTIGS)=0gnBaseSource [pure virtual]
SetFilter(gnFilter *filter)gnFileSource [inline, virtual]
~gnBaseSource()gnBaseSource [inline, virtual]
~gnClone()gnClone [inline, virtual]
~gnFileSource()gnFileSource [inline, virtual]

Generated on Mon Feb 3 02:34:47 2003 for libGenome by doxygen1.3-rc3